Hello,

please excuse that there was no answer to your post yet :oops: .

With most Epson printers it is possible to create something like a "Super Weave" mode by modifying a printer description file within PrintFab so that the printer uses more passes to produce the image which usually eliminates "banding" and other irregularities (if such a problem is currently visible in the highest print resolution).

Please let me know which printer you have and I will send you information how to modify the printer description file.
